ABC's "Nashville" has survived cancellation thanks to the loyal fans who support the country musical drama. ABC apparently decided to cancel the show earlier this year and it sparked a remarkable fan campaign to rescue the series. 

After a successful fan-lead campaign to save "Nashville" from the horrid clutches of cancellation, the series will be back for Season 5 on January 5, 2017. According to TV Series Finale, the cast and crew of "Nashville" are grateful and very much moved by the effort of the fans to keep the show alive. Therefore, they promise to make the new season worth the effort.

Now that "Nashville" Season 5 has been confirmed and fans are simply waiting for its air date to arrive, there are more challenges faced by the hit musical drama. The fact that the show transferred from network to cable means that "Nashville" Season 5 is bound to have lower ratings.
